What are the selection techniques for bedding fabrics?
1. Polyester-cotton brand products generally use a polyester-cotton fabric with a ratio of 65% polyester and 35% cotton. Polyester-cotton is divided into two types: plain weave and twill weave. The plain-weave polyester-cotton fabric has a thin surface, good strength and abrasion resistance, and minimal shrinkage. The appearance of the finished product is not easy to lose. It is affordable and durable, but it is not as comfortable and fit as pure cotton.
2. Yarn-dyed pure cotton is a kind of pure cotton fabric, which is woven with warp and weft yarns of different colors. Because it is dyed first and then weaved, the dye permeability is strong, the color fastness is good, and the heterochromatic yarn fabric has a strong three-dimensional effect and a unique style. The bedding is mostly in the pattern of strips. It has the characteristics of pure cotton fabric, but usually shrinks more.
